Customertimes VP of Business Development Salary

The average Customertimes VP of Business Development earns an estimated $162,727 annually. Customertimes' VP of Business Development compensation is $48,375 less than the US average for a VP of Business Development.

The Business Development Department at Customertimes earns $3,688 more on average than the Marketing Department.

VP of Business Development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female VP of Business Development at companies similar size to Customertimes reported making $289,257, while the average male VP of Business Development at similar sized companies reported making $251,458.

VP of Business Development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ian VP of Business Development at companies similar size to Customertimes reported making $263,559, while the average Hispanic or Latino VP of Business Development at similar sized companies reported making $220,000.
